首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

C++添加到lambda的末尾

C++添加到lambda的末尾是指在Lambda表达式中使用C++语言的特性和功能。Lambda表达式是一种匿名函数,它可以在需要函数作为参数的地方使用,例如在算法函数、容器函数、回调函数等场景中。

在C++中,Lambda表达式的语法如下:

代码语言:txt
复制
[capture list](parameters) -> return_type { 
    // 函数体
}

其中,capture list是用于捕获外部变量的列表,parameters是函数参数列表,return_type是返回值类型(可以省略),函数体是Lambda表达式的具体实现。

将C++添加到Lambda的末尾意味着在Lambda表达式的函数体中使用C++语言的特性和功能。这可以包括但不限于以下内容:

  1. C++标准库:可以使用C++标准库提供的各种容器、算法、字符串处理、文件操作等功能,以实现特定的业务逻辑。
  2. C++语言特性:可以使用C++语言的特性,如模板、多态、异常处理、RAII等,以提高代码的可复用性、可扩展性和安全性。
  3. 第三方库:可以使用各种第三方库来扩展Lambda表达式的功能,例如Boost库、OpenCV库、FFmpeg库等,以实现更复杂的功能需求。
  4. 并发编程:可以使用C++的多线程、原子操作、互斥锁等机制,以实现并发编程和提高程序的性能。
  5. 底层操作:可以使用C++的指针、引用、内存管理等特性,以进行底层的内存操作和性能优化。

Lambda表达式中添加C++语言的特性和功能可以使代码更加灵活、高效,并且可以根据具体的业务需求进行定制化开发。在云计算领域中,可以将C++添加到Lambda的末尾,以实现各种云原生应用、网络通信、音视频处理、人工智能等功能。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券